1. Introduction to Online Casinos

Online casinos have revolutionized the gaming industry, offering players the convenience of playing their favorite games from the comfort of their homes. Unlike traditional casinos, online casinos provide a wide range of games, from slots and poker to blackjack and roulette. With the advancements in technology, online casinos have become more realistic and engaging, providing players with an immersive experience.

3.1 The United States: A Complex Scenario

The United States has a long and complex history with online gambling. In 2006, the Unlawful Internet Gambling Enforcement Act (UIGEA) was passed, which made it illegal for banks and financial institutions to process payments for online gambling. This act had a significant impact on the online gambling industry in the United States, leading to the closure of several online casinos.

Despite the UIGEA, some states have continued to allow online casinos, while others have banned them outright. The legal landscape is constantly evolving, with some states legalizing online casinos and others reconsidering their stance.
